Tuck shop owner gunned down in eSikhaleni

Zulu was leaving his tuck shop container near uMkhobose when unknown men approached and opened fire

GUNSHOTS echoed across KwaNdaya Reserve in eSikhaleni on Sunday night, and when community members arrived at the scene they found well known tuck shop owner Sbusiso Zulu (39) dead in a pool of blood.

His body was riddled with several bullet wounds.

According to reports, Zulu was leaving his tuck shop container near uMkhobose when unknown men approached and opened fire.

Police recovered 14 cartridges at the scene.

A case of murder was opened at eSikhawini SAPS.

The motive for the fatal shooting is unknown at this stage.

According to police, a huge manhunt is under way and they urged the community to come forward with any information about the incident.
